Has anyone any idea what I should be looking for or how I might fix this problem? Order Editor is set to update stock if "Check stock level" at Administration->Configuration->Stock is set to 'true'. However after looking at this again it probably makes more sense to go by the setting of "Subtract stock". If you have "Check stock level" set to 'false' but "Subtract stock" set to 'true', do this: go into the code for admin/edit_orders.php and change every instance of STOCK_CHECK to STOCK_LIMITED Edited August 2, 2006 by djmonkey1 Quote Do, or do not. djmonkey1 Posted August 3, 2006 Share Posted August 3, 2006 Doesn't look good :( The amout of "ot_coupon" os added the the total amout (all products + tax) but it has no effect to the tax. No matter if we add or substract something to the bill :( This problem makes me crazy :wacko: First off, you have to enter a tax rate in the "Shipping tax" field. Secondly, in the screenshot you showed the value was displayed as a negative. The problem you're having with it being added to the total would only occur if it was stored as a positive value. If it's stored as a positive but meant to used as a negative the changes will have to be very different. Quote Do, or do not. There is no try. Order Editor 5.0.6 "Ultra Violet" is now available!
